A Gift To 2 Crore People: PM Modi Inaugurates 91 FM Transmitters

PM Modi said that the transmitters will play a key role in timely dissemination of information regarding weather and will prove helpful for women self-help groups.

Prime Minister Narendra Modi virtually inaugurated 91 FM transmitters across 18 states and 2 Union Territories of the country on Friday. During the inauguration, PM Modi said that the transmitters are a gift to 2 crore people who will soon have access to the facility.

"Today, this expansion of the FM service of All India Radio is an important step towards becoming All India FM. This launch of 91 FM transmission of All India Radio is like a gift to 2 crore people of 85 districts of the country," the Prime Minister was quoted as saying by ANI.

He also said that the transmitters will play a key role in timely dissemination of information regarding weather and will prove helpful for women self-help groups.

"Be it timely dissemination of information, weather forecasts for agriculture, or connecting the women's self-help groups with new markets these FM transmitters will play a key role. Infotainment of FM has a lot of value," said the PM.

Highlighting the importance of technology, the PM said that it is important that everyone should have access to affordable technology for which his government is working hard.

"Our govt is continuously working towards the democratisation of technology. Every citizen should be able to afford and have access to technology. We are. All India Radio has a vision of connecting the nation. The affordability of mobile devices and data plans has enabled widespread access to information," said PM Modi.

"The tech revolution has led to shaping radio and FM in a new way. Radio hasn’t gone obsolete. Through online FMs and podcasts, it has come in a new avatar. Digital India has given it new listeners. Today many education courses are available on DTH services. FM radio & DTH have both shown a window to the future of Digital India, the Prime Minister further said during the inauguration.
